VK.NET

Вконтакте API для .NET (C#)

Разработка проекта VkNet

Supported by Jetbrains.

На главную

Метод Friends.AreFriends

Возвращает информацию о том, добавлен ли текущий пользователь в друзья у указанных пользователей. Также возвращает информацию о наличии исходящей или входящей заявки в друзья (подписки).

Этот метод можно вызвать с ключом доступа пользователя. Требуются права доступа: friends.

Страница документации ВКонтакте friends.areFriends.

Синтаксис

public IDictionary<long, FriendStatus> AreFriends([NotNull]IEnumerable<long> userIds, bool? needSign = null)

Параметры

Результат

После успешного выполнения возвращает массив объектов status, каждый из которых содержит следующие поля:

user_id — идентификатор пользователя (из числа переданных в параметре user_ids); friend_status — статус дружбы с пользователем:

Исключения

Пример

// Получение информации о том добавлен ли текущий пользователь в друзья у указанных пользователей и проверяет наличие исходящей или входящей заявки в друзья (подписки).
var uids = new long[] {176382, 298320, 389320};
var dict = vk.Friends.AreFriends(uids);
if (dict[298320] == FriendStatus.NotFriend)
{
  .....
}

Версия Вконтакте API v.5.103

Дата обновления: 17.01.2020 15:40.

comments powered by Disqus